dc.description.abstract | In this research, the Functional Lumen Imaging Probe (FLIP), a novel measurement tool, was adapted to measure the biomechanical properties and morphological changes of the ano-rectal region during distension and provocative manoeuvres. Two customs made FLIP probes (prototype 1& prototype 2) and original EndoFLIP® (prototype 3) were developed and tested in bench top studies and in pilot studies. | |
